Single Serving Strawberry Pumpkin Scone

The perfect sweet and savory simple treat!

This strawberry pumpkin scone is the perfect sweet and savory treat! In this recipe, our olive oil is used as the binding agent and adds a healthy fat. This recipe is also a single serving which is perfect for a quick dessert craving or you can double it and share with a friend!

 
We recommend Vitality in this recipe because of its more neutral flavor compared to Joy. Vitality’s earthy undertones compliment the pumpkin extremely well. 

  


Ingredients: 

  • 30 grams of flour 

  • 1/4 tsp baking powder 

  • ¼ tsp of cinnamon 

  • 1 tablespoon of Vitality Olive Oil
  • Pinch of salt 

  • 20 grams of pumpkin puree (not pumpkin pie filling, but if you like a super sweet scone go for it!)

  • 10 grams of sugar-free maple syrup 

  • 25 grams of strawberries 

  • 5 grams of cashew milk (or any other milk alternative) (For the glaze)

  • Powdered sugar (For the glaze)

Directions: 

  • Preheat oven to 350℉ and line a baking sheet with parchment paper. 

  • Mix together the dry ingredients (flour, baking powder, cinnamon, and pinch of salt).

  • Add in wet ingredients (pumpkin puree, maple syrup, olive oil) and thoroughly mix before adding the next ingredient. 

  • Fold in strawberries carefully so they do not get squished. 

  • Once all ingredients are combined, plop your batter onto the parchment sheet and shape it into a scone (any shape will do but the traditional drop shape is always a favorite). 

  • Cook for about 15-20 minutes or until golden brown. 

  • Mix together the powdered sugar and milk alternative to make a simple glaze for your scone. 

  • Once the scone is cooled, drizzle your glaze onto your scone and enjoy!
